Southern made smoothbore large caliber percussion pistol made by "J. M. Happold in 1862, Charleston, South Carolina. Browned smoothbore barrel with small iron blade front sight. Barrel marked "Charleston, S.C." and has "Flag and Cannon Breech with pile of Cannon Balls" scene engraved on top of tang. Scroll engraved percussion lock with " J.M. Happold 1862" stamped on lock. Lock held with engraved single bolt and controlled by a single trigger. Walnut stock with checkered grip with iron furniture and silver thumbpiece with illegible letters in script. Comes with hardwood ramrod. PROVENANCE: Comes with letter stating previous sale data and from "Billy Allen" collection. CONDITION: Metal parts turning an aged brown patina with some light surface rust. Lock is missing hammer screw. Wood has dry aged finish with a small chip on left side near muzzle and a hairline crack near muzzle on right. Dark bore with pitting and mechanisms are sticky. DLM
